one year on heres our story!
 
Well guys for those that remember me, its been a year since our arrival in australia - and whoaaaaaahhhh what a ride!!!!

lets start at the beginning, my family and I came out here in march last year on a 139 designated area sponsored - which i believe no longer exists now!!
anyway, we arrived in stanthorpe - which is a lovely country town out west and stayed with my family for a few weeks, we needed the R&R after a traumatic last week in england, saying goodbye and living in a hotel after we had sold the car and house - frightening thought but exciting all the same.
We arrived in stanthorpe excited and looking forward to our new life, and i can honestly say i havent been disappointed yet!
We stayed with a friend in a suburb called indooroopilly for a week, which i can definitely recommend as a nice suburb, close to the city. Then our quest began for a house, we trawled the internet and newspapers and first found a house on the east coast at ormiston which was lovely, but unfortunately 4 other couples thought so too so we missed out on that one!! (as is the norm here when renting - especially close to the city)
we decided to let fate take its course and pretty much closed our eyes and simply "picked" somewhere between stanthorpe and brisbane, and low and behold along came Parkinson!!! on the southside
great suburb nice houses, nice people, good schools etc. etc. so we looked around on the net again and found a house that we liked it was a four bedroom lowset, ensuite, double garage again pretty much the norm for new estates at a cost of $330 per week. We got it and lived there happily on a 12 month lease, parkinson is 30 mins from the city and 45 from the gold coast, 1 hour from the sunshine coast so pretty central to everything, i decided on a complete new career change so decided to retrain in hairdressing!!! we bought completely new furniture from scratch at a cost of approx $15,000 all in all but that can be drastically reduced!!!! we also bought a car etc. arranged medicare, insurances, utilities, tax, usual stuff.
as the year has gone on, we have met lots of people along the way, enjoyed bris and the coasts on weekends and just enjoyed life. We have recently moved to the northside of brisbane and are enjoying that too, same size house etc but a bit cheaper lol!! my son is in a new school (he settled ok in his old one) my husband is working a casual stress free job and i finish my course in 8 weeks, i work in a salon part time and they have asked me to go full time when i finish.
We absolutely love australia, the stress and stain of the past couple years going through the whole TRA and application is definitely worth it, i have no thoughts or inclination to return to the UK and i dont particularly miss anything about the UK (apart from one or two friends of course!!) i wouldnt swap our life for the world!! we look out of our window and see a beautiful freshwater reserve and park and feel generally much safer here (rightly or wrongly!!) the weather is fantastic 99.9% of the time and even when it rains its still a great day.
in a nutshell for me, the worst days here are still tons better than the best days in the UK!!

lol we live five mins from petrie, a little village called kallangur!~!!!
its lovely up here - most places are in brissy!
redcliffe beach is 15 mins away and petrie has a wonderful old village to visit and a national park, it is beautiful!! petrie markets are very quaint and its only half hour on the train to the city, australia zoo, maleny etc are not too far either
the sunshine coast is right on your doorstep and the motorway isnt far if you fancy travelling a little further up or down the coast!
